文章目录log4j2的配置,不同级别日志保存在不同文件夹(基于Springboot)1.前言汇总2.log4j2.xml的实际配置 log4j2的配置,不同级别日志保存在不同文件夹(基于Springboot)1.前言汇总目的是想按照按照规定的格式打印在控制台,以及以文件的形式保存下来,并且按照日志的级别,保存为不同的log文件.首先你得搭建一个简单的springboot项目,这个就直接在网上查,
转载
2024-03-20 09:28:41
56阅读
其实 spring boot 默认 使用 logback 的,,, 而且如果我们想 使用 log4j 也是可以的。。。 因为 里面内置的 Tomcat 可以直接使用 log4j 类的来记录的 比如:import org.apache.log4j.Logger;
private Logger log = Logger.getLogger(this.getClass());
当然 只需要在 a
转载
2023-12-27 16:57:33
74阅读
1,添加如下到pom.xml中 <!-- 移除logging --> <d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ter</artifactId> <exclusions>
原创
2021-07-19 14:37:29
456阅读
log4j2.0以后我们通常在log4j2.xml中配置相关参数,在配置的时候我们需要理解这些参数的具体含义,下面列出了这些参数的解释。1、Logger 完成日志信息的处理<logger name="com.srd.ljzd" level="INFO" additivity="true">
<appender-ref ref="INFO" />
<ap
转载
2023-09-03 10:32:13
220阅读
简介Java 中比较常用的日志工具类,有:Log4j、SLF4j、Commons-logging(简称jcl)、Logback、Log4j2(Log4j 升级版)、Jdk LoggingSpring Boot 默认使用 Logback,但相比较而言,Log4j2 在性能上面会更好。SpringBoot 高版本都不再支持 log4j,而是支持 log4j2。log4j2,在使用方面与 log4j 基
转载
2024-08-13 13:53:12
166阅读
Log4J的配置文件(Configuration File)就是用来设置记录器的级别、存放器和布局的,它可接key=value格式的设置或xml格式的设置信息。通过配置,可以创建出Log4J的运行环境。1. 配置文件 Log4J配置文件的基本格式如下: #配置根Logger log4j.rootLogger = [ level ] , appenderName1 , ...
原创
2022-11-21 19:59:02
838阅读
配置输出日志到控制台我这里使用xml配置Spring Boot 1.3.x以上版本的pom文件如下:<dependency>
<groupId>org.springframework.boot</groupId>
<artifactId>spring-boot-starter-log4j2</artifactId>
<
转载
2024-02-21 10:54:41
24阅读
开发工具用的STS4(eclipse),springboot版本是2.1.9.RELEASElog4j2的配置文件网上关于log4j2.xml的配置介绍有很多,基本稍微改下就能用,这里我就不再赘述了。有两个问题要说下: 第一,application.yml(或application.properties)下要不要配置log4j2.xml的路径?如果配置文件名为log4j2.xml(log4j2-
转载
2024-03-26 20:24:21
179阅读
log4j配置示例[plain] view plain copy#定义根日
转载
2022-06-02 12:34:59
295阅读
# 使用log4j集成MongoDB进行日志记录
在开发中,我们经常需要记录应用程序的运行情况和错误信息,以便于后期排查问题和优化性能。而log4j是Java中一款非常流行的日志记录框架,它提供了丰富的日志记录功能,可以方便地记录不同级别的日志信息。
如果想要将log4j集成MongoDB,可以通过配置log4j.properties文件来实现。下面我们来介绍一下如何进行配置。
## 配置l
原创
2024-06-19 04:25:48
72阅读
动手试一试这里省略Spring Boot项目的基础创建,如果您还不会可以看本教程的快速入门。下面的操作你可以基于Spring Boot 2.x中默认日志框架Logback一文的例子继续下去,也可以用任何一个Spring Boot 2.x的项目来尝试。第一步:在pom.xml中引入Log4j2的Starter依赖spring-boot-starter-log4j2,同时排除默认引入的sp
转载
2024-03-19 13:54:47
12阅读
集成Log4J日志1.Log4J概述2.集成Log4J22.1 引入依赖2.2 添加Log4J配置2.3 创建log4j2.xml文件3.使用Log4J记录日志3.1 打印到控制台3.2 记录到文件3.3 测试 本章主要回顾Log4J的基础知识、在Spring Boot中集成Log4J、Log4J在Spring Boot中的运用以及如何把日志打印到控制台和记录到日志文件中等内容。Spring B
转载
2024-04-18 12:56:55
131阅读
自动加载配置文件:(1)如果采用log4j输出日志,要对log4j加载配置文件的过程有所了解。log4j启动时,默认会寻找source folder下的log4j.xml配置文件,若没有,会寻找log4j.properties文件。然后加载配置。配置文件放置位置正确,不用在程序中手动加载log4j配置文件。如果将配置文件放到了config文件夹下,在build Path中设置下就好了。
转载
2023-10-17 15:18:23
156阅读
@ "toc" 首先要导入log4j属性文件 Log4j.properties 在resources文件夹下导入log4j.properties文件,复制下面的内容时,每行后面如果有空格的话一定要去掉,log4j.appender.File.File为log日志存放的路径。 Pom.xml添加依赖
原创
2021-12-22 11:17:31
684阅读
0:背景: 集成日志能对代码运行做到更好的监控,及时定位故障。1、Maven项目的创建模块:1、maven项目的创建建议使用spring init模块,之后添加相应包即可,创建完成后结构如下:2:spingboot集成log4j2日志 第一步:在创建完成web项目的基础上添加log4j2依赖:
转载
2023-12-20 22:15:47
61阅读
以前整合过log4j2,但是今天再次整合发现都忘记了,而且也没有记下来1.pom.xml中 (1)把spring-boot-starter-web包下面的spring-boot-starter-logging排除 <dependency>
<groupId>org.springframework.boot</groupId>
<
转载
2024-03-18 20:48:51
87阅读
一、log4j.properties配置文件Log4j默认的配置文件是log4j.properties,将该文件置于classpath下,容器启动时会初始化Log4j。Log4j把日志级别由低到高依次分为ALL、TRACE、DEBUG、INFO、WARN、ERROR、FITAL和OFF等。其中,级别高的会屏蔽低的信息。如果设置为WARN,则INFO、DEBUG都不会输出。二、5个重要的概念Log4
转载
2023-10-16 14:23:08
327阅读
Log4j应该是目前项目开发中使用最广的日志记录框架,一般配置Log4j只需要配置Log4j的属性文件在src目录以及引入Log4j的jar包即可,但是如果项目比较大的时候,我们需要将一些配置文件放入自定义的项目目录里面,传统的方法显然不能满足需求,下面讲解一下Log4j在Springmvc项目中的配置及工作原理: web.xml文件配置:<context-param>
转载
2024-02-18 15:30:06
249阅读
常用log4j.properties配置文件 log4j.rootLogger = info,console #指定serviceImpl层 日志输出 log4j.logger.com.sms.service.impl = info,D log4j.logger.com.sms.aop=info,D
原创
2024-08-23 14:52:27
97阅读
添加log4j的类库如果你使用了Maven来管理依赖,在pom.xml中添加如下配置,其它形式自行对应<!--添加属性log4j版本-->
<properties>
<log4j.version>1.2.17</log4j.version>
</properties>
...
<!--添加属性log4j依赖-->
&l
转载
2024-06-22 16:18:04
1063阅读